Crushing setting: Efficiency. Ideally, the reduction ratio of a jaw crusher should be 6:1. There are different ways to calculate reduction ratio, but the best way is something called the P80 factor. The reduction ratio is then calculated by comparing the input feed size passing 80 per cent versus the discharge size that passes 80 per cent.

Reduction Ratio Of Crushing Rolls. automatic double roll crusher. roll crusher machine has a theoretical maximum reduction ratio of 4:1. if a 2 inch particle is fed to the roll crusher, the absolute smallest size one could expect from the crusher is 1/2 inch. toothed roller crusher will only crush ...
